

Elizabeth Makow, 97, was born March 20, 1927 in Poland, to Boleslaw and Julia Lipnicki. She died Wednesday, June 26, 2024 at Northwest Community Hospital, in Arlington Heights, Illinois surrounded by her loving family.
Mrs. Makow will be remembered as the neighborhood greeter, waving to all from her front porch bench as they passed her home, was an avid gardener and would often be found tending to her plants surrounding her house. She couldn't wait for Spring so she could start on her tomato plants, which she loved to share with everyone. She was a caring, adoring, and loving mother, grandmother, aunt and friend. One way she exhibited her love was by cooking and making sure all were well fed. 1st thing she would ask when you came over was "are you hungry".
Throughout her life, she exemplified a rare selflessness, always putting the needs and well-being of others above her own. Whether it was lending a listening ear to a friend or quietly supporting her family through every challenge, she embodied compassion and generosity in every action and decision.
Elizabeth is survived by her children, John (Anita Kite) Makow, Donna Makow, Stan (Lynn) Makow, and Teri (Tony) Rossi; and her grandsons Nicholas and Stephen Rossi, who were the light of her life.
She is preceded in death by her husband, Stefan Makow, her parents, brothers and sister.
